What does healthy masculinity actually look like in media? In A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ms, the character Ser Duncan the Tall offers a surprisingly powerful example of emotionally healthy masculinity. He shows vulnerability, reflection, responsibility, and care—especially in his mentorship of Egg (Aegon V Targaryen).
